Fragrance free, 1930 2-bdrm Craftsman farmhouse on 3 acres at the edge of town

Located in Santa Rosa, enjoy what this fabulous 2-bedroom fragrance free farmhouse has to offer. Take a step back in time at our 1930 “Craftsman with Character” situated alone on three beautiful acres centrally located on the northeast edge of Santa Rosa in the heart of wine country, just 25 miles from Bodega Bay and the ocean, 30 miles to the Napa Valley and 55 miles from San Francisco.
This spacious two-bedroom, one bath farmhouse boasts 1200 square feet of living space which makes for a large kitchen, family room and bedrooms. There are 8 steps to enter the home, central heating, portable A/C and plenty of uncovered parking.
Both bedrooms are furnished with a king bed (one Casper Eastern and one Beautyrest Cal King) with toppers, a ceiling fan, a relaxing/reading area, charging stations and a dresser. Each bedroom closet has an extra blanket, a personal fan, a full-length mirror, hangers, and robes to borrow. The Craftsman is well insulated from street noise, but it is located on a road with moderate traffic, morning commute through early evening. A white noise machine and earplugs are provided for guests in the street side bedroom for those with noise sensitivity.
The main living area is split into two spaces- a comfy family room with plenty of seating and a 55” smart TV. Also, an electric fireplace, air purifier, book library and armoire with many games, puzzles and arts supplies. The other area is set up for playing games, doing puzzles, doing art, working or as an additional dining space.
As is common in these old homes, the single bathroom has a clawfoot tub with shower. Provided are bath towels, makeup towels, a blow dryer, and a multi plug outlet with USB ports just waiting for you to relax after a fun day in Sonoma County!

Things to note:
There are cameras on the property. One faces the parking area, one faces the back field, one faces the front field and one is at the front door.

This is a 1930 farmhouse on 3 acres. What that means is that though some of the features of the home have been updated, we have chosen to keep the craftsman charm alive. So, the floors are painted or covered with area rugs, the sinks and clawfoot bathtub are original, the kitchen has the original wallpaper, the stove is gas from 1940, and the 85-year-old refrigerator stands 5 feet tall with a 8” x 12” x 14" freezer. There may be smells and noises unfamiliar to a modern house. Also, you may see honeybees (4 hives on the back edge of the property), spiders, lizards, foxes, racoons, turkeys, deer and other wildlife. And did I mention dust? There are two horse stables within a stone’s throw which means….dust! If the above features are unattractive to you, I invite you not to book this home.

Clean, comfortable, spacious, and with tons of amenities. Very nice hosts, very responsive to my questions. They provide books, games, puzzles, boxes of Kleenex everywhere, and even provided a carton of eggs in the refrigerator. The kitchen is fully stockedwith silverware, dishes, and food-prep utensils. The windows are all double-paned, providing excellent sound-proofing. The living room has a free-standing air conditioner unit. The single bathroom has a claw-footed tub that also serves as a shower. It's a bit tricky to climb into and out of the tub since the grab bar is across the room from the tub. You can sit on the deck or under the trees and enjoy the tranquil country surroundings.
